Microbrewery or Bar? Weighing Your Options for Entrepreneurial Triumph

Embarking on a new venture in the beverage industry requires careful consideration. Selecting between opening a brewery and a pub presents distinct challenges and advantages. A microbrewery concentrates on producing beer to distribute wholesale, demanding large investment and expertise in fermentation processes. Conversely, a bar focuses on providing beverages and cuisine directly to consumers, necessitating operating a customer-facing personnel and securing a desirable space. Ultimately, the optimal route depends on your personal goals, monetary resources, and market awareness.

This Realities of Pub Operation: Challenges and Rewards

Venturing into pub operation presents a unique blend like both significant difficulties and substantial payoffs. Several aspiring proprietors envision a life filled with cozy evenings and bustling crowds, but the actual realities can be far more rigorous . Owners often face intense competition, fluctuating beverage costs, strict licensing requirements, and the perpetual requirement to retain customers. Efficiently navigating these issues requires not only economic acumen but also a deep understanding regarding the local area and a relentless effort ethic.

  • Managing staffing can be especially difficult.
  • Upkeeping quality levels is essential.
  • Fostering a loyal customer base takes time .
  • Despite such hurdles, the chance to establish a thriving gathering place, produce a comfortable living , and experience a vibrant social scene makes pub operation a truly rewarding undertaking for the right person.
